## Formula sandbox tuning

User-supplied formulas in Gridmoor execute inside a restricted interpreter with hard ceilings on time, memory, and call depth. Reviewers should confirm any change to these ceilings is justified in the PR description, since raising them widens the abuse surface. Defaults were chosen from production traces. The current limits are as follows.

limits module of tafog-fawip:
WEIGHTS = {
    "julix": 57,
    "lamys": 992,
    "kasvan": 209,
    "quenok": 750,
    "alddor": 259,
    "oliath": 1009,
    "wenix": 815,
}

## Date Localization Provenance

Plugin authors targeting the Mirelark platform must not bundle their own locale tables. Date format rules are compiled into the host at build time and versioned with the release, so plugins always resolve formats against the host's provenance record. To verify which locale dataset your plugin will see in production, check the host build reference below.

trace token, kagap-tajof: htk21_8f49353f7c83f26d11962

# Annual Billing Move — Managers Only

Quick update for branch managers on the shift to annual billing for Skylarch subscriptions. Short version: monthly plans close to new sign-ups next quarter, existing customers get a discount nudge to switch, and renewals route through the new Tollgate workflow. Expect some pushback at the counter — talking points are on the shared drive. Commission timing changes too, so check the revised schedule before promising anyone anything. The confidential note on the wider business plan sits just below.

board note of kageg-bahof: The renewal with Holwynax Holdings closes at $2 million a year, 5 percent below the last contract. Project Ulaath slips by two quarters because of the supplier delay.

**Ticket: Scrubwell vault sealed — EXIF pipeline blocked**

Contractor note: the Scrubwell EXIF-stripping job can't fetch its signing key because the Dorvane vault sealed itself after three failed auth attempts. Images are queuing unscrubbed; do not publish anything until the pipeline clears. Unseal only from the bastion host and log the action in the runbook. To unseal, enter the recovery passphrase below.

vault phrase of tajop-haduf = holath-brivan-wenax